What Does a Farm Insurance Agent in La Mesa Cost?

Farm insurance costs in California vary widely. A basic policy for a small hobby farm might start around 500 to 800 dollars per year. A larger commercial operation with multiple structures and high liability limits can cost 2,000 to 5,000 dollars or more annually. Factors include crop type acreage livestock count and location relative to fire zones. This is general information and not insurance advice.

Frequently Asked Questions

What does farm insurance cover in La Mesa?
Farm insurance typically covers barns fences irrigation systems livestock and crop loss. It also includes liability protection if someone is injured on your farm. Policies can be customized for specialty crops common in California like avocados and citrus.
Do I need workers comp insurance for farm workers in California?
Yes California law generally requires workers compensation insurance for any farm with employees. This includes seasonal and part-time workers. Penalties for not having coverage can be severe including fines and stop-work orders.
How does California wildfire risk affect farm insurance in La Mesa?
Wildfire risk is a major factor for farm insurance in California. Many insurers require brush clearance and fire-resistant building materials. Your agent can help you understand coverage for fire damage and additional living expenses if your home is on the farm.
